Anne French
Career summary
Assistant and later Deputy Curator, Kenwood House, 1979-89.
Keeper of Fine Art, Laing Art Gallery, Newcastle upon Tyne, 1994-2000 (job-share).
Curator ‘Below Stairs: 400 years of Servants’ Portraits’, National Portrait Gallery/Scottish National Portrait Gallery, 2003-4 (with Giles Waterfield).
Former regional Committee Member for The Art Fund.
Former Editor ‘Bewick Journal’ (for The Bewick Society).
Areas of interest / research
The Grand Tour.
Regional British Portraiture (North East England).
Portraits of British Servants.
British 17th and 18th century portraiture.
Details of books/publications relating to your work on British portraiture
John Joseph Merlin, ‘The Ingenious Meckanick’, The Iveagh Bequest, Kenwood, 1985.
The Earl and Countess Howe by Gainsborough: A Bicentenary Exhibition, The Iveagh Bequest, Kenwood, 1988.
Below Stairs, 400 Years of Servants’ Portraits (with Giles Waterfield), National Portrait Gallery, 2003.
Art Treasures the North: Northern Families on the Grand Tour (Unicorn Press, 2009); includes discussion of Grand Tour portraits from the Northern Region.
